How to replace Cleaned with a stronger action verb:

Let's look at examples of how you can remove and replace the overused phrase, Cleaned, with a stronger synonym and alternative that is more effective at highlighting your achievements.

Before: Weak example using Cleaned

Cleaned tons of raw data to get insights

After: Using a stronger synonymAnalyzed 5GB of raw data from 20+ sources to provide the chief security officer with actionable intelligence. .

Replacing Cleaned with Organized

Before: Cleaned

Cleaned and managed lots of data files

After: OrganizedOrganized 10,000+ company data files into an efficient, searchable system that saved the team 15 hours per week in manual search time.

As a hiring manager, the 'before' example does not stand out due to its lack of specifics. By quantifying the candidate’s experience and impact in the 'after' example, it showcases their ability to bring about efficiency.
